Suggest Therapy For Stasis Dermatitis & Ulcers On My Right Lower Leg & Ankle

Hi Doctor, For the last 2 months I have been suffering from Stasis Dermatitis & Ulcers on right lower leg & ankle. One Ulcer only is also on the left ankle. In fact earlier Doctors could not diagnose it. Only on Aug.29,2014 a skin doctor diagnosed it as such. First treatment for 5 days was (1) pouring a very dilute & transparent solution of potassium permanganate with a cotton swab for 1 minute(2)Cream Clop GM application three times(3)One tablet CNN 100 at night(4)One tablet ZeminPB after food at morning & night; and(5)one tablet Zempred 4 after food at morning. It proved working. For the next 20 days i.e. up to Sept.22, 2014 the doctor prescribed (1)cream Moisrize in the morning and night (2)Cream Clop E at alternate night (3)one tablet Zemin PB morning & night (4)one tablet Zempred4 in the morning on alternate days. The doctor advised the use of potassium permanganate solution as & when a need is felt. So I am doing this on and off. This treatment is also working. Right leg s Ulcers are 90% healed. The lower half of the right leg s skin has become very tender/delicate(perhaps less thick than normal)shining & brownish. Left leg s skin is normal & healthy but an ulcer on ankle is not healing properly and often irritates/itches. Further I can t stand or sit even for a reasonable duration. At under-side i.e. at the sole of both feet, a type of un-explainable sensation starts and heavyness is felt. Obviously it is impossible to always lie on the bed with legs raised above the heart level 24 hours daily for indefinite period. At a stage when healing is not 100%, the compression wrap can also not be done. So how can I lead a routine life doing daily activities. Please advise. I am a 68 years old retired male person weighing 64 Kgs and was until now leading a normal routine life. In fact I used to feel a burning sensation in my feet for the last 15 years or so, but never gone to a doctor for the problem. I have been advised for the time being not to walk. Further on appearance of ulcers about 2 months ago, i got done a blood test, which inter alia showed cholestrol very high. So I want to reduce it to normal for which too I may please be advised. I also want to do such effective / fruitful physical exercises which do not involve sitting, standing, leg-movements etc.due to the stasis dermatitis and ulcers. It is very necessary for my wellness/fitness. Please help me. Thanks and regards, J.C.Saini

* Through all the narrations , it is indicative of non healing ulcer but the
etiology part is not on highlight as narration of any reports or evaluation
done to diagnose the cause of it .
* Unless the cause is rooted , it is not possible to treat it till full recovery
which may be - varicose veins - chronic infection - diabetes - deformities
of immune related system - other ailments as HIV , tuberculosis

* For cholesterol , dietary management to avoid dairy fat , high caloric food
non veg , junk foods , ghee , butter , paneer are better to be avoided

* Exercise guidance can be availed from physiotherapy fellow .
